Output 51c95aff46b0c1fa6bca48821ae8150bfae38c25cbb8ac455e7aadce3953960d:1

value
1062882
script pubkey
OP_0 OP_PUSHBYTES_20 1c6ec875cf56ea71da475ee7679071c68792ffcc
address
tb1qr3hvsaw02m48rkj8tmnk0yr3c6re9l7veccqsv
transaction
51c95aff46b0c1fa6bca48821ae8150bfae38c25cbb8ac455e7aadce3953960d